Cheraw Dance, popularly known as Bamboo dance, is performed in Mizoram in North Eastern India to ensure a safe passage for the soul of a mother who died during childbirth. Cheraw is a dance of sanctification and redemption performed with great care, precision, and elegance—the dance form uses bamboo staves kept in cross and horizontal forms on the ground. While one set of dancers moves these bamboo staves in rhythmic beats, the others perform by gracefully stepping in and out of the bamboo blocks.\
